Situated along the Strand beachfront in Cape Town on the shore of False
Bay, you will find the eye catching Hibernian Towers on Strand’s Golden
Mile, offering a well appointed 2 bedroom, 2 bathroom apartment
providing the perfect combination of luxury and comfort.
Take full advantage of the sizeable, fully equipped kitchen which
includes a dishwasher and all your culinary necessities which looks
onto a very inviting lounge area with a cozy couch and a flat screen
TV. Enjoy your favourite meals at the intimate dining space that
accommodates four guests, which leads out onto a stylish undercover
patio area with outdoor furniture and gas barbeque facilities, all
while overlooking an area with convenient lift access.
The well appointed bedrooms ensure to provide a well deserved peaceful
nights rest. The main bedroom offers a queen size bed, access to the
patio as well as an en-suite bathroom with a shower while the second
bedroom offers a double bed and utilizes a shared bathroom with a
bath.
Make the most of the on-site amenities which include a heated pool area
with a steam room, a gym, a day spa, a restaurant, a coffee shop, a
convenience store, and a hairdresser or venture out and enjoy the
majestic 5-kilometer-long white beach, the shoreline is lined with a
promenade featuring a variety of restaurants, cafés, and shops, while
nearby attractions include Melkbaai Beach, Dune Park with its super
tube and mini-golf, and Harmony Park with its expansive tidal pool. For
the sports enthusiasts there are an internationally rated golf course
to tennis courts, rugby fields, squash clubs, and exciting water sports
like board sailing, surfing, power boating, and paddle skiing. The area
is particularly popular among surfers, thanks to "The Pipe," a
designated surfing spot renowned for its excellent waves.
Additional features offered to guests include two dedicated secure
parking bays and 24-hour security in the building, internet access as
well as linen and towels provided for your stay.
The apartment is conveniently located just a 30-minute drive from the
airport and 10 minutes from Somerset West Mall, the scenic Stellenbosch
and the world-famous wine routes.

About the area
Cape Town, South Africa, is a city that captivates with its stunning natural beauty, rich history, and vibrant cultural scene. Nestled between the iconic Table Mountain and the sparkling Atlantic Ocean, Cape Town offers a feast for the senses and a plethora of activities for all types of travelers.
The majestic Table Mountain, a New7Wonders of Nature, provides a dramatic backdrop for the city. Adventurous visitors can hike to the summit or take a leisurely cable car ride to enjoy panoramic views of the city and beyond. The nearby Cape Point, part of the Table Mountain National Park, is another natural wonder where the Atlantic and Indian Oceans are said to meet.
Cape Town's history is deeply intertwined with that of South Africa, and sites like Robben Island, where Nelson Mandela was imprisoned, offer poignant insights into the country's past. The colorful Bo-Kaap neighborhood, with its cobblestone streets and brightly painted houses, reflects the city's multicultural heritage and offers a glimpse into the Cape Malay culture.
The Victoria & Alfred Waterfront is a bustling hub where visitors can shop, dine, and enjoy entertainment against the backdrop of the working harbor. The Two Oceans Aquarium and the Zeitz Museum of Contemporary Art Africa (MOCAA) are also located here, providing cultural and educational experiences.
For those interested in wildlife, the Boulders Beach penguin colony is a charming excursion where you can observe African penguins in their natural habitat. The surrounding winelands, such as Stellenbosch and Franschhoek, offer world-class wine tasting tours amidst picturesque landscapes.
Cape Town's culinary scene is a reflection of its diverse influences, with a range of dining options from traditional South African braais (barbecues) to gourmet international cuisine. The city's markets, like the Old Biscuit Mill's Neighbourgoods Market, are a foodie's delight, offering a variety of artisanal foods and local crafts.
Outdoor enthusiasts will find plenty to do, from surfing at the famous beaches of Clifton and Camps Bay to paragliding off Lion's Head. The Kirstenbosch National Botanical Garden is a serene spot for a picnic or a concert against the backdrop of the mountain.
In essence, Cape Town is a destination that offers an exceptional blend of natural beauty, historical depth, cultural richness, and adventure. Its warm climate, friendly locals, and breathtaking landscapes make it a must-visit on any traveler's list.
